 Description  « Hide
JIRA's full content view now uses CSS to force pagebreaks between issues. This works in IE6 (see JRA-4226), but apparently causes excessive whitespace around issues. See Neal's excellent summary at:

http://forums.atlassian.com/thread.jspa?messageID=257218940&#257218940

Since it seems to be something users might normally wish to tweak, we should move this option to the General Configuration page.

Jeff Turner [Atlassian] - 25/Aug/05 07:48 PM
Need to get more information on this issue - where exactly is the whitespace, and can we tweak the HTML so that it doesn't occur? If so, that would be a better solution than providing a flag.

Neal Applebaum - 26/Aug/05 07:46 AM
Just a thought.. since different users use different browsers, and each version of their preferred browser may work differently, maybe the flag that controls this behaviour, whatever it turns out to be, should be configurable for each user (in edit profile) as opposed to each system. So, if there's a flag "Ignore page break requests in Full content view" or whatever it turns out to be, each user can set it based on how their version of their browser works. That way you don't have to worry about pleasing every version of Firefox, I.E., etc. etc. I don't know if that's possible within the framework of JIRA, but it might be easier, support wise, in the long run. That way you don't have to issue patches every time Firefox sends out a release or some user has installed some custom extension, etc.
